Board & Batten in a Community Like Sudden Valley
Sudden Valley sits in a different microclimate than a lot of Bellingham. Homes here are tucked among tall conifers, ringed by Lake Whatcom's humidity, and shaded for long stretches of the day. That combination — shade, tree cover, and lake moisture layered on top of Whatcom County's driving rain and long moss season — means siding here has to deal with slower drying times than a home out in the open. Board and batten is a popular look in this kind of setting because the vertical lines read well against the trees and the terrain, but it's also a style that punishes a sloppy install faster than standard lap siding does.

Why This Style Is Riskier to Get Wrong
Lap siding sheds water down and away by design — each course overlaps the one below it. Board and batten works differently: wide vertical boards with narrower battens covering the seams between them. Water runs down the face of the boards and can find its way into the vertical joints if the battens, fasteners, and flashing details aren't handled correctly. In a sunny, dry location that forgiving margin might not matter much. In a shaded Sudden Valley lot where a wall can stay damp for days after a storm, small installation mistakes turn into real moisture problems.
Where Sudden Valley Homes Take the Most Punishment
- North- and east-facing walls that get the least direct sun and the most standing shade from surrounding trees
- Lower walls and foundation lines where lake-driven humidity and ground moisture linger longest
- Roof-to-wall intersections and dormers, where board and batten seams meet flashing and are easy to under-detail
- Areas under overhanging branches, where organic debris collects and holds moisture against the siding face
What a Correct Board & Batten Install Actually Involves
The finished look of board and batten is simple — vertical boards, evenly spaced battens, clean shadow lines. What's underneath that finish is where the job is won or lost.
The Rainscreen Gap
A proper install includes a drainable rainscreen — a vertical furring strip or engineered gap between the weather-resistant barrier and the siding — so any water that does get behind the boards can drain and the wall can dry on both sides. This matters more in Sudden Valley than almost anywhere else in our service area, because the shade here slows evaporation. A wall with no gap that stays damp for days at a time is a wall that eventually shows rot, mildew, or paint failure, even if the siding material itself is sound.
Fastening and Batten Placement
Battens need to land over real backing and be fastened with the right spacing and depth — not just decoratively nailed to the face. Fasteners that miss framing, or that are driven too deep and crack the substrate, create entry points for water right where the batten is supposed to be protecting the seam.
Flashing at Penetrations and Transitions
Every window, vent, light fixture, and roofline transition needs flashing detailed to shed water outward, layered correctly with the weather barrier — not caulk used as a substitute for flashing. Caulk breaks down; flashing doesn't.
Factory-Finished Material
Board and batten cut and finished on site, especially in raw wood, exposes cut edges and end grain that soak up water fastest. Factory-primed and factory-finished material with sealed edges, cut and coated correctly on site, holds paint and resists moisture far longer.
Why We Only Install James Hardie for This Look
Board and batten can be built in cedar, engineered wood like LP SmartSide, vinyl panel systems, or fiber cement. We install James Hardie fiber cement exclusively, and in a location like Sudden Valley the reasoning is more than a preference — it's about which material actually survives long-term shade and moisture without turning into a maintenance project.
Where the Alternatives Fall Short Here
Cedar board and batten looks excellent when new, but it's wood — it needs re-staining or re-painting on a real schedule, and in a shaded, damp setting like Sudden Valley that schedule gets shorter, not longer. Skip a cycle and cupping, checking, and rot follow. Engineered wood products use resin-treated wood strand cores that perform well when installed and maintained exactly to spec, but any breach in that engineered coating — a missed caulk line, a nick during install — gives moisture a path into a wood-based core, and shaded walls don't dry that damage out quickly. Vinyl board and batten is low-maintenance but it's a thin plastic product that flexes with temperature, can crack in cold snaps, and was never engineered as a moisture-management wall system — it's a cladding, not a rain-managed assembly.
Why Fiber Cement Holds Up
James Hardie board and batten is non-combustible fiber cement, engineered in HZ product lines for climates exactly like the Pacific Northwest's — sustained moisture, moderate temperatures, long wet seasons. It doesn't rot, it doesn't feed moss and mildew the way bare wood grain does, and the ColorPlus factory finish is baked on and warranted against fading and peeling, which matters on a shaded home where a painted finish already fights harder to look clean.

Our Process on a Sudden Valley Job
1. Site and Shade Assessment
We walk the property and note which walls sit in constant shade, where tree canopy overhangs the roofline, and where past moisture or moss problems show up on the existing siding or trim. That shapes the rainscreen and flashing plan before a single board is ordered.
2. Tear-Off and Substrate Check
Once the old siding comes off, we check the sheathing and framing underneath for hidden rot, especially at the bottom plates and around windows — issues that are common on shaded walls that have been trapping moisture for years without anyone knowing.
3. Weather Barrier and Rainscreen Install
A correctly lapped weather-resistant barrier goes on first, followed by the drainable rainscreen gap, sized and installed to let the wall breathe and drain on the shaded sides of the home.
4. Board and Batten Install
Boards go up plumb and true, fastened into solid backing, with batten spacing planned for even shadow lines. Every cut edge gets sealed before it's closed up.
5. Flashing and Trim Detail
Windows, vents, and roof transitions get flashed correctly — caulk is the last line of defense, never the first.
6. Final Walkthrough
We walk the finished job with the homeowner, point out what a healthy wall looks like, and go over a maintenance schedule suited to a shaded, lake-humid lot.
Maintenance That Actually Matters Here
- Rinse siding and battens down at least once a year to clear pollen, needles, and organic debris that hold moisture against the surface
- Trim back branches and vegetation that keep any wall in constant shade or drip directly onto the siding
- Check caulk lines at window and trim transitions annually — replace anything cracked or pulling away before winter rains set in
- Watch north- and east-facing walls for early moss or mildew film, since these dry slowest in a Sudden Valley lot
- Clear gutters and downspouts before the wet season so roof runoff isn't dumping directly onto board and batten walls
